Create impact and join Risk Division as an Executive Manager Technology Risk (UNITE)
Whats the role
This role will play a crucial part of the UNITE team. UNITE is our business-led tech-enabled transformation and a key priority for the Group. UNITE is about delivering one best way to make our processes systems and tech simpler so we can deliver a better experience for our customers and make things easier for our people.
As an Executive Manager Technology Risk (UNITE) youll provide second line oversight insight and challenge over technology and cyber risks across the UNITE transformation program.
Sitting within the Risk Division youll support the Head of Technology Risk and divisional Chief Risk Officers to ensure change execution risks are identified assessed and managed in line with Westpacs Three Lines of Defence model. Youll attend key governance forums review and challenge material changes provide risk insights to senior stakeholders and escalate emerging or material risks where required.
This role is fully dedicated to UNITE combining deep technical expertise with strong risk judgement to help ensure transformation outcomes are delivered safely and within risk appetite.
This is a Sydneybased role with flexible work options (3 days in office)
